Subject[PATCH v3] mm,writeback: fix divide by zero in pos_ratio_polynom
On Wed, 30 Apr 2014 15:48:26 +0200
Michal Hocko <mhocko@suse.cz> wrote:

> This is still prone to u64 -> s32 issue, isn't it?
> What was the original problem anyway? Was it really setpoint > limit or
> rather the overflow?

This patch should avoid math overflows with both the initial
subtraction, and with use of the truncated divisor by div_s64
and div_u64.

I added redundant casts in the div_s64 and div_u64 calls to
make it clear what those functions do internally, which should
make it easy to understand why we do the same cast in the if
statements right above.

I believe this version of the patch addresses everybody's concerns.

---8<---

Subject: mm,writeback: fix divide by zero in pos_ratio_polynom

It is possible for "limit - setpoint + 1" to equal zero, leading to a
divide by zero error. Blindly adding 1 to "limit - setpoint" is not
working, so we need to actually test the divisor before calling div64.

Signed-off-by: Rik van Riel <riel@redhat.com>
---
mm/page-writeback.c | 13 +++++++++++--
1 file changed, 11 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

diff --git a/mm/page-writeback.c b/mm/page-writeback.c
index ef41349..6405687 100644
--- a/mm/page-writeback.c
+++ b/mm/page-writeback.c
@@ -598,10 +598,15 @@ static inline long long pos_ratio_polynom(unsigned long setpoint,
unsigned long limit)
{
long long pos_ratio;
+ long divisor;
long x;

+ divisor = limit - setpoint;
+ if (!(s32)divisor)
+ divisor = 1; /* Avoid div-by-zero */
+
x = div_s64(((s64)setpoint - (s64)dirty) << RATELIMIT_CALC_SHIFT,
- limit - setpoint + 1);
+ (s32)divisor);
pos_ratio = x;
pos_ratio = pos_ratio * x >> RATELIMIT_CALC_SHIFT;
pos_ratio = pos_ratio * x >> RATELIMIT_CALC_SHIFT;
@@ -842,8 +847,12 @@ static unsigned long bdi_position_ratio(struct backing_dev_info *bdi,
x_intercept = bdi_setpoint + span;

if (bdi_dirty < x_intercept - span / 4) {
+ unsigned long divisor = x_intercept - bdi_setpoint;
+ if (!(u32)divisor)
+ divisor = 1; /* Avoid div-by-zero */
+
pos_ratio = div_u64(pos_ratio * (x_intercept - bdi_dirty),
- x_intercept - bdi_setpoint + 1);
+ (u32)divisor);
} else
pos_ratio /= 4;
